Latest from Dave, Chris, and Marty:

For You

The Band:

2692:Organ, Rhythm ModernPopSlowMike Ev 075
1002:Guitar, 12-String Acoustic, Rhythm ClassicRockA-B Ev16 065
803:Guitar, Electric, Rhythm DrivingCountryBalladClean Ev 065

Bass Guitar: Marty Straub, aka BabuMusic
Drums: EZDrummer2

I'm playing the lead guitar.

Mixed with Reaper, mastered with Ozone9, all details available on request.

Man, you write the best reviews! Chris always enjoys them too smile

For the B3 I use the Scheps Omni-Channel plugin from waves. I bought it a while ago on sale for $29. The only thing I use it for is B3 tracks actually, but for that alone it’s worth the $29 IMHO, it really brings them to life.
